    A guy named John got word about some of the success The Blitz Room had with original acts on the weekends and in 1998- the forementioned circuit started it's way there. John's format in theory on how bands got paid made sense. He issued tickets to each band and would pay them on how many got turned in that night. The problem was, he didn't always consistently give bands diffrent colored tickets, and that caused problems. And along with that was inconsistent communication on when which band would play. John's errors were two things I had to clean up on a band's behalf, and I made one particular band's shit list holding my ground, and that took 2 years to rebuild an instantly burned bridge.
